EMBARCADERO — Attend an evening dedicated to the “Science of Cocktails” at the Exploratorium on Friday, January 22 from 9 p.m. to 12 p.m. The $120 ticket (available here) includes an open bar, hors d'oeuvres and cocktail-related activities.
SONOMA — The 15th annual Martini Madness event is taking place at Saddles Steakhouse on Friday, January 8 from 5 p.m. to 7 p.m. in honor of The Sonoma Valley Olive Festival. Twelve local restaurants and bars will compete for the best use of the olive, most creative and best overall martini, and there will also be olive-inspired appetizers; get your ticket here.
SOMA — The Contemporary Jewish Museum is hosting a panel discussion on “How Technology is Reinventing Food” with The Economist’s Anne Schukat moderating. Get your ticket to the Thursday, January 7 event here.
HEALDSBURG — Charlie Palmer’s Dry Creek Kitchen is holding a series of wine dinners celebrating Sonoma County wines that start with a pre-dinner wine tasting and continue with a four-course, wine-paired meal. The next one focuses on Merry Edwards on January 8, followed by Failla on February 5 and Hartford on April 8. Call 707-431-0330 to reserve.
